Brazos Small Cap Fund is managed by a team of 12 seasoned investment professionals whose research process involves the application of bottom-up, fundamental research, as well as consistent communication with a company's senior level managers, suppliers, competitors, and customers in an attempt to understand the dynamics of each its business. JMIC researches individual businesses, and invests in those with strong growth in revenue, earnings and cash flow, modest financial leverage, predictable operating models, experienced management and unique products or services.

About John McStay Investment Counsel and the Brazos Mutual Funds

Dallas-based John McStay Investment Counsel, small- and mid-cap growth investing specialist, was founded in 1983. The firm currently oversees approximately $2 billion, primarily for institutional investors as well as the Brazos Mutual Funds. JMIC's portfolio managers have an average of 10 years with the firm, and an average of more than 17 years of investment experience. The firm is majority owned by American International Group
